Eric Nikolaus Kwasnjuk is a Philly native of South African and Ukranian descent. He began acting on the New York City stage. Appearing in over 20 plays. Some of his early mentors were Victor Garber at Herbert Berghof Studios & Director/Playwright Shauneille Perry Ryder at Herbert Lehman College & The New Federal Theater. Memorable roles include the King in the "King and I" , Othello, Andrei in "The Three Sisters" and the U.S premiere of Russian playwright Vladimir Mayakovsky's "The Bedbug" receiving great reviews in the lead role of Ivan Prisypkin. He helped form the Grown Up's Playground Improvisation Troupe at the New York City Comedy Club and then began performing stand-up comedy in comedy clubs across the United States. Working alongside comics such as Jim Gaffigan, Zach Galifianakis, Dave Chappelle. Eric honed his writing and production skills as an assistant at ABC-TV on "Regis and Kathie Lee" and Good Morning America. He interned at Universal Studios in Los Angeles, under the guidance of Film Director-Frank LaLoggia- "Lady in White." In 2014 he moved to Cape Town , South Africa to attend Afda Film School receiving a Bachelors of Honors in Motion Picture Medium. While living in Cape Town he wrote and directed two award winning documentaries. "The Cape of Good Humor" and "The Cape of Lost Lullabies" as well as a sitcom pilot for TV, "Who U Kiddin?" His film career as an actor blossomed in South Africa in notable award winning films such as "Happy Earth Co" "The Doll Shop", Winning Best Actor at various festivals. Appearing in the Syfy series "Dominion". Returning to the states he studied Meisner for three years at Playhouse West. His role as Alva in the feature film "Neon Fangs" will be released in 2021. in 2019 he relocated to Los Angeles. Coaching with Shari Shaw, Barry Papick, Lisa London etc. Performing comedy at the Improv on Melrose and the Comedy Store and as an actor/writer at the Station House Theater Company under Gareth Williams. Fun fact- Eric is the only contestant in it's 49 year history to appear onstage and win the showcase two separate times on "The Price is Right" game show. in 2000 and 2020 respectively.
